Sarah Steckler is a Productivity Strategist who helps online entrepreneurs organize their brain & business through mindful productivity so they can turn ideas into journals, planners, and profit producers without the burnout! She's the host of the Mindful Productivity Podcast with new episodes airing every Monday to help you organize your life & biz. She's the author of multiple journals including 100 Life Challenges, the Mindful Productivity Planner, and the Daily Productivity & Brain Dump Book. Her mission centers around creating sustainable daily practices that feel organized & productive so you can create the time freedom you want.

India Jackson is the CEO of Flaunt Your Fire, a visual marketing agency known for taking an unapologetically authentic strategy to branding and visibility that gets real ROI. From Christian Dior to coaches and their staff, over the last 11 years, her team has provided consulting, strategy, photography, training, and more for their clients. She has an Art + Design degree yet credits her unique perspective to her years of experience transitioning from model to published photographer and her pastime as an award-winning plant-based bodybuilder. India loves disrupting the way people view career labels, branding, visibility, and ultimately themselves.

Toughness and Enoughness with Sonja Wieck
/Sonja Wieck underwent a life affirming transformation taking her from an average stay-at-home mom who wanted to strive for more to a top Ironman triathlete, with nothing but passion, drive and determination. She can be seen leading her group of 3 men on Team Iron Cowboy on Mark Burnett’s new competition show “World’s Toughest Race Eco-Challenge Fiji” hosted by Bear Grylls premiering on Amazon Prime on August 14, 2020. At the ripe age of 40, she is a 6x Kona Ironman World Championship Qualifier and Competitor, has participated in 18 Ironman competitions, came in 2nd place at Kona Ironman World Female 35-39 age group (2015), was named the Ironman All World Female 35-39 Champion (2013), Tokyo’s Joe’s Athlete of the Month (2014), participated in multiple Ultramarathons finishing up to 100 miles, ran the Grand Canyon Rim to Rim in 12 hours, was named the Moab 100 mile Female Champion and 2nd overall (2010) and that’s just the half of it. She is the host of the brand new podcast called “Tales of Toughness” that will launch in August 2020 where each week she will feature interviews with some of the 330 participants on the “World’s Toughest Race Eco-Challenge Fiji.” Her mission is simple: to encourage men and women of all ages that you can push yourself to do the impossible, but if you strive for success and achievement for your own ego, you will be left unfulfilled. It is when you pursue your dreams for your own personal growth, you learn the most about yourself, and are able to show up best for others around you. Sonja wants people to know life is about more than ourselves but giving back and helping others, and this is what is missing from competitive sports. She currently resides in Los Osos, CA, near San Luis Obispo with her husband of 18 years and their 14-year-old daughter.
Sonja Wieck is here to share about her journey through toughness and enoughness. Despite being an 18X Ironman competitor and most recently a finisher on the World's Toughest Race EcoChallenge airing now on Amazon Prime, she struggled with embodying enoughness. You will love her perspective on the physical, emotional and spiritual aspects of toughness and how that helped her to understand she is enough today.
